: While Pro Tools 12.5 generally ignores system-wide dark mode settings, some users have reported that enabling "Invert Colors" (Accessibility settings) or using Windows "High Contrast" themes can create a dark-like effect, though it often makes plugins and waveforms look distorted.
The short answer is . Avid Pro Tools 12.5 does not feature a native, built-in Dark Mode toggle.
